  • Patent number: 6189138
    Abstract: A method, apparatus, and program code visually constructs object-oriented application software to be installed on a distributed object system. The method of the invention includes the following steps. Initially, the method provides a catalog facility which contains components having references to pre-existing objects within a distributed object system. A component is selected from the catalog facility for inclusion in the application software. A part corresponding to the object referenced by the selected component is derived from the selected component. The part is then made available to an application construction environment. In this environment, the part can be linked to at least one other part that also references a pre-existing object in the distributed object system. Graphical facilities are provided within the application construction environment for selecting and defining links among parts.

  • Patent number: 5920868
    Abstract: A method, apparatus, and computer program product for selecting and reviewing a distributed object installed on a distributed object system. A method of the invention includes generating a library of components corresponding to distributed objects on the distributed object system, which includes one component corresponding to the distributed object. Each of the components of the library includes information describing the distributed object to which the particular component corresponds. The contents of the library are displayed using a catalog interface device. The library is browsed using the catalog interface device to identify the component corresponding to the distributed object which is then selected. At least a portion of the information describing the distributed object is displayed.

  • Patent number: 5720018
    Abstract: An improved technique for monitoring computer processes and their attributes using a three-dimensional graphical image. The three dimensional graphical image is formed by displaying the graphical objects associated with the computer processes and their attributes. The physical relationship between the various graphical objects within the graphical image preferably model the actual relationships between the processes and their attributes. The computers which run or activate the processes may also be represented by a graphical object within the graphical image. As the attributes of the computer processes change, the characteristics of the graphical objects are quickly adjusted and the three-dimensional graphical image is updated to reflect the changes to the attributes of the computer processes being monitored.
